About this song

"You Were Born to Die" by Cat Clyde is a haunting rendition of the traditional Appalachian folk song. The song features Cat Clyde's soulful vocals accompanied by her fingerpicked acoustic guitar, creating a raw and intimate atmosphere. The use of slide guitar adds a bluesy touch to the track, enhancing its emotional depth. Overall, "You Were Born to Die" showcases Cat Clyde's ability to breathe new life into classic folk tunes with her unique style.
